Common Causes of Sweaty Feet:

Sweating is one of the most common phenomena of our body. It makes your feet vulnerable to the bacteria and germs as well as create an unpleasant smell to make an odd situation. 

Many people think why they start sweating all of a sudden. Sweat is just water with some lactic acid, urea that comes out from our body by a process called perspiration 

If you wonder what causes sweaty feet, here I am sharing some causes that are usually responsible for sweaty feet—

1.Any Foot Conditions:

Some foot conditions like anxiety or athlete’s foot sometimes create excessive foot sweating. 

2.Environment:

If you work hard in a hot environment or work for a long time, excessive sweating may occur. 

3.Boot Type:

Using a heavy-duty work boot or an insulated boot will also cause foot sweating. 

4.Hyperhidrosis:

Sometimes the sweat glands of our body may lead to a condition that creates continuous production of sweat even in the resting stage. Such a condition is known as hyperhidrosis feet. 

5.Hormone:

Increasing the level of some hormones in our body, like thyroid hormone (or hyperthyroidism) can also cause excessive sweating.

How To Stop Sweaty Feet?

Here are some simple ways to keep feet from sweating and feel comfortable in work boots—

1.Track Record of Sweating Episode:

If you keep the records of sweaty feet, you will be able to find and identify the pattern, like the situations, emotions, or food that trigger your foot sweating. So, you can limit and avoid those triggers to decrease sweating. 

2.Wear the Right Socks:

You can decrease sweating of your feet by choosing the best socks to keep feet dry in work boots

During summer, you can wear cotton socks for adequate ventilation and wool socks for the winter season. Try to avoid synthetic or nylon socks as they trap the moisture. 

There is another type of sock that can draw away the moisture from your skin known as moisture-wicking sock. They are mainly found in the sporting goods store. 

Another type of socks that contain chemicals, or have ventilation panels to reduce bacteria on your feet, so it helps to minimize the odor and foot moisture. 

3.Home Remedies for Sweaty Feet:

You can try using some home remedies to keep your feet dry. One of the most effective ways is to soak your feet in normal black tea. The remedy is simple, all you need to do is, put two to three black tea bags in a basin full of warm water and soak your feet. 

Black tea contains tannins that close the pores of the skin and thus reduce sweating. You should soak your sweaty feet to the tea water for about 20 minutes daily to get an effective result. 

Also, if you wash your sweaty feet frequently, the bacteria and sweat will be rinsed away and cool your skin down to reduce further sweating.

4.Use Antifungal Powers:

Antifungal foot powders are supposed to keep your skin odor-free and dry, so it will decrease foot sweating. You can use cornstarch to your feet, too. Though it will not fight fungus, it also can help to decrease sweating. 

5.Use Antiperspirants:

There are about 1,25,000 sweat glands in each foot of a human body and the number is higher than any other parts of our body. Using an antiperspirant is one of the most effective remedies for sweaty feet.

The AAD (American Academy of Dermatology) recommends applying antiperspirant deodorant to dry feet before going to bed and washing it off the next morning. You can use it for 3-4 consecutive nights. 6.Wear the Right Shoes:

You can wear a pair of shoes with breathable fabric like leather or canvas. Try to avoid plastic or patent shoes because they block airflow and trap sweat inside. 

Also, you will need to wear the correct sized shoes as too tight shoes will crowd the toes and create sweaty feet. Additionally, deodorizing or absorbent insoles can also provide relief from sweating and odor.

7.Apply Rubbing Alcohol:

Applying a small amount of rubbing alcohol can give you fast relief. Just dab some rubbing alcohol in between the toes and the most sweaty areas of your feet, it will instantly dry out your skin. However, using rubbing alcohol on a daily basis may cause skin irritation. 

8.Clean Your Feet Daily:

Do not forget to clean your feet while taking bath. Also, you should wash your feet after coming back from work, or at least once a day. Moreover, scrubbing your feet once or twice a week with antibacterial soap and warm water will help keep feet free from sweating.
